Vidéotron will broadcast Super-Skills Competition and all-star game in High Definition television

February 4, 2004 - Press Release

Montréal, February 5, 2004 - Vidéotron will carry the CBC/HD broadcasts of the NHL All- Star Super-Skills Competition at 6:30 p.m. on Saturday, February 7, and of the NHL All- Star Game at 3:00 p.m. on Sunday, February 8, on channel 606 in High Definition Television (HDTV).

Vidéotron is able to bring its subscribers the sport events in HDTV because of its unique hybrid fibre-optic/coaxial cable two-way broadband network and its HD illico digital platform.

Access
To access the HDTV feed of the broadcasts, Vidéotron subscribers need an HDTV television set and an HDTV illico set-top box.

Vidéotron subscribers in the greater Montréal area will be able to tune in the HDTV broadcast of the Super-Skills Competition and the All-Star Game on channel 606 of Vidéotron's digital cable service.

Vidéotron Ltée, a wholly-owned subsidiary of Quebecor Média inc., is an integrated communications company active in cable television, interactive multimedia development and Internet access services. Vidéotron Ltée is a leader in new technologies, thanks to illico, its interactive television system and its high-bandwidth network allowing it to offer, among other services, high-speed cable Internet access, analog and digital TV services. In Quebec, Vidéotron serves 1,433,000 million cable customers; more than 240,000 also subscribe to interactive TV on its digital service illico. Vidéotron is also the leader in high-speed cable Internet access throughout Quebec, with more than 435,000 Internet customers by cable modem and dial-up modem.
